Artisan and Eureka Scholarships awarded in special school assembly

 

Westholme is very proud to have financial support from local businesses Artisan Interiors and Emica, in the form of Scholarships and the Eureka Essay awards.

Alyas Khan, CEO of Emica launched the Eureka Award in the Summer term and visited to award the winning prizes of £150 each to Rachael Moodie (Seniors) and Malini Dey (Juniors).  He was impressed with the creativity of the ideas all the girls had presented and said, “These essays have depth of imagination and ideas for regeneration that are amongst the best the panel have seen. Congratulations.”  He was also pleased to award the Eureka Scholarship for £500 to Emma Watts for the highest performance in Geography based on external GCSE results. Mr Khan commented that all the girls who had been awarded prizes from his company would be guaranteed work experience and interviews at the end of their studies.

       

Katy Hill, former pupil and parent of Westholme came to award the Artisan Interiors Scholarship to Jodie Clegg, who had excelled in her Art GCSE examination. Jodie was delighted with the £500 award to enhance her studies. Mrs Hill, a director of Artisan Interiors, said that it was extremely rewarding to help a talented girl through her learning, and she looked forward to seeing Jodie’s future work.
